Key Differences

In short — Ryzen 9 7900 outperforms Core i7-875K on the selected game parameters. We do not have the prices of both CPUs to compare value. The better performing Ryzen 9 7900 is 4612 days newer than Core i7-875K.

Advantages of AMD Ryzen 9 7900

  • Performs up to 56% better in Dota 2 than Core i7-875K - 264 vs 169 FPS
  • Consumes up to 32% less energy than Intel Core i7-875K - 65 vs 95 Watts
  • Can execute more multi-threaded tasks simultaneously than Intel Core i7-875K - 24 vs 8 threads
  • Works without a dedicated GPU, while Intel Core i7-875K doesn't have integrated graphics
